    Sadly, as far as I know, the only tracks that have names that we know of are on the FFXIV Field Tracks and Battle Tracks album. Of these, some of the names are kind of interesting - especially 'Opening Theme' for the iconic theme that winds up being used in character creation, rather than in any opening.

    I LOVE Van Darnus' theme. It's so ominous, so terrifying - there's something about the rhythmic four-beat underlying structure that fills me with dread. It reminds me of the Master's Theme from Doctor Who, that might be part of why it gets to me so much.

    Oh, and the Gobbue theme, of all things! It sounds like something Mitsuda would have written, in all the best ways. I love the soundtrack to this game, both old tracks and new, and can probably dork about it for hours given the chance. XD

    Ooh, and I forgot: the dungeon theme! Back before there were any dungeons in the game (!) it drove me crazy not knowing where that theme would play. When it finally popped in when I did Toto-Rak for the first time - and then when it went crazy when I started fighting something - it was pretty incredible. I love the use of dynamic scoring in dungeons; I wish the normal field/battle tracks were at least motif reflections of each other.
